Women's Hoops Picks Up Win at Life Pacific

SAN DIMAS, CA — The University of La Verne women's basketball team took a short trip down Arrow Highway to pick up their first win of the season, defeating the Life Pacific Warriors 72-61.

How it Happened
  • Trailing 7-6 early, the Leopards ended the first quarter on a 13-4 run, highlighted by two Marissa Howell three-pointers to take the lead for good.
  • The Warriors and Leopards keep pace in the second quarter each scoring 13 points. Life Pacific shot 50 percent from the field but couldn't close the deficit.
  • Allison McGill went off in the third quarter, scoring 13 points off 5-5 shooting from the field with three three-pointers and two rebounds.
  • Howell finished strong, scoring eight points in the fourth with two more makes from beyond the arc to seal the win.
Notables
  • McGill scored a team and career-high 18 points. She made four three-pointers, grabbed six assists, and had one steal.
  • Alyssa Smith grabbed 16 rebounds to tie her career-high. She scored 14 points and had four assists. It is her second double-double of the season.
  • Howell made four three-pointers and totaled 14 points. Howell's career point total is now at 994.
  • The Leopards made 10 three-pointers.
  • Adrianna Torres led the Warriors with 12 points.
Records
  • The Leopards improve to 1-4 overall.
  • Life Pacific drops to 3-6.
